Default If you elect to participate in any non golf cart activity

do so defensively. This is a recommendation from a daily 2-3 mile per day walker (me!). While the majority of golf cart drivers are very attentive and take the proper care the others are very dangerous. They drive to fast and I am convinced some can not see....why else would they run up on a walker facing traffic and almost hit them?

So enjoy the multi modal paths....travel against the flow of the golf carts....and keep your eyes on the oncoming traffic.......and don't forget to wave.

Just as an aside I would estimate more than half of everybody on the path either waves or says good morning, etc. I do!!
